India's Defence Manufacturing - From Imports to Becoming a Major Exporter
India's defence manufacturing sector has undergone a remarkable transformation in recent years, evolving from a nation heavily reliant on imports to one with aspirations of becoming a global defence exporter. Traditionally, India was one of the world’s largest importers of military equipment, sourcing everything from fighter jets to artillery from foreign suppliers. However, in response to growing security challenges and the need for strategic autonomy, India embarked on a journey to develop indigenous defence capabilities.
This shift, driven by the "Atmanirbhar Bharat" (Self-reliant India) initiative and supported by key policy reforms, has seen India emerge as a rising player in the global defence market. Today, India is not only strengthening its own military infrastructure but is also positioning itself as a key exporter of advanced defence technologies and systems.
